Workers’ Comp Insurance for Pet Boarding and Daycare Employees

  • Feb 11
  • 2 min read

Running a pet boarding or doggy daycare business involves more than caring for pets—it also means protecting your employees. Handling animals, cleaning kennels, and managing active play areas carry real risks. That’s why workers’ compensation insurance is an essential part of pet boarding business insurance.

Understanding how workers’ comp works ensures your staff stays safe and your business stays compliant with state regulations.

What is Workers’ Compensation Insurance?

Workers’ compensation (workers’ comp) insurance provides medical coverage, wage replacement, and rehabilitation benefits to employees who are injured or become ill while performing work duties. For pet boarding and daycare facilities, common injuries include:

  • Dog bites or scratches

  • Slips and falls on wet floors

  • Lifting or handling large or multiple animals

  • Allergic reactions or stress-related injuries

Without workers’ comp, your business could face costly lawsuits or out-of-pocket medical bills.


Why It’s Critical for Kennels and Daycares

Most states require businesses with employees to carry workers’ compensation insurance. Even if your kennel is small, hiring part-time or full-time staff triggers this legal requirement.

Beyond compliance, workers’ comp protects your team and demonstrates that you value employee safety—a key factor in staff retention and building trust with clients.


How Coverage Works

Workers’ comp policies cover:

  • Medical expenses for on-the-job injuries

  • Lost wages if the employee cannot work

  • Rehabilitation costs

  • Legal defense if the employee sues for a workplace injury

Premiums are typically based on your payroll, number of employees, and the type of work performed. Pet care facilities may pay around $0.75–$2.50 per $100 of payroll, though rates vary by state and risk profile.
